Transaction 5797887251281a50276015cfc3c2877c4a56e61c17f6c07d904f9f72f87bbc55
1 Input
1 Output
-
5797887251281a50276015cfc3c2877c4a56e61c17f6c07d904f9f72f87bbc55:0
- value
- 407584
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 55bb6e4246c493a25e302c22d3a7cc4438e4f210 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18pJyDhCKWd3mi9x5K4DxkzrmRT2HtkMgK